A Career Advancement Programme in Social Health Technology User Experience (UX) equips participants with the skills and knowledge to excel in designing user-centered healthcare solutions. The programme focuses on improving the user experience within social health technologies, emphasizing accessibility, usability, and effectiveness.
Learning outcomes include mastering user research methodologies, designing intuitive interfaces for health applications, and understanding the regulatory landscape of healthcare technology. Participants will gain proficiency in prototyping, usability testing, and iterative design processes, all crucial for successful social health technology UX design.
The duration of the programme is typically tailored to the participant's existing experience and learning objectives. It could range from a few intensive weeks to several months, often including a combination of online and in-person learning modules, workshops, and practical projects.
